But what are private label rights?
To understand why private label rights are so special, you need
to know about resale and master resale first.
Resale rights are simply permission from the owner of a work (a
book, for example) to allow you to take the said material and
distribute it for your own profit.
Master resale rights take it a step further and allow you to
sell the resale rights to the work. The reason why it is called
master resale rights is because it covers a large set of
permissible actions to the person who acquires those rights.
Experts would tell you that to get the most of your purchasing
of master resale rights, the following list of actions should
allow you to: 1. give the material away unaltered
2. combine the material with others
3. give the material away as a bonus item 4. use the material
as content for websites
5. divide the product into separate articles
6. put the rights for the material or the material itself up for
auction
7. provide the material as content for paid membership sites
8. sell resale rights for the material
9. change or alter the material
Buying the whole set of these rights are great but it can cost
you. But there is a way to get almost all of these actions and
not have to pay as much for master resale rights IF you acquire
just the right to change or alter the material, which is exactly
what private label rights are.
